The Gonubie beachfront is undergoing a much needed facelift just in time for the school holidays, thanks to a local business which has called on the community to roll up their sleeves and take part in a paint party from 10am today.
Nigel Connellan, managing director of Western Gruppe, which owns the Gonubie SuperSpar, said a team of three was busy fixing the log fence along the verge of Deary Drive and that five sets of concrete picnic tables, benches and bins were on their way to Gonubie from Johannesburg and should be installed before Christmas.
